What they do
A Science Teacher teaches in the natural science fields for elementary to secondary school students. Most science courses taught prior to high school are general, with specialization occurring later in high school. Teachers may teach specialized courses in physics, biology or chemistry. Other topics taught include physical science, computer science, astronomy, and geology.

Motivate and teach students scientific attitudes through courses in general, earth, physical science or other sciences using the required course of study.Job Qualifications:
Must have a Bachelor's and/or Master's degree in Education. Must have or be eligible for licensure and certification in Delaware for Secondary Science and/or Middle Level Science. Experience in various content areas to successfully teach exceptional standards-based instruction in areas to ensure academic growth for all students, including those with special needs. Experience in automated student information systems for progress and grade reporting and class work documentation and ability to integrate technology into instructional delivery. Exceptional classroom management, organization, planning, instructional delivery, leadership and technical skills and the ability to utilize differentiated instructional methods to engage students in positive learning experiences. Outstanding ability to motivate and build relationships with students and parents to promote student achievement and strengthen community partnerships. Commendable history of effective leadership, extra-curricular participation, an acceptable attendance record and exemplary performance.Essential Functions:
Develop daily and unit lesson plans and a scope and sequence that are thoughtful, goal-oriented and aligned with curriculum and integrate technology; maintain pace of learning and provide opportunities for student differences; and check for student understanding and convey appropriately high expectations for students. Carefully plan for substitute teachers when unable to attend school and relate lessons to the state content standards in the core content areas as well as in specific content area. Create and maintain a classroom environment to encourage all students to be engaged and work toward meeting the standards; maintain accurate, thorough records of student achievement and behavioral performance; and complete progress and grade reports promptly and as scheduled using automated systems. Promote a high rate of student interest and provide prompt and specific feedback in a constructive manner and opportunities for active participation; demonstrate fairness and consistency in dealing with students; and speak and write clearly, correctly and at an appropriate level for student understanding. Comply with policies, regulations and procedures of school district and building; communicate effectively with parents and work collaboratively with staff. Display high level professional conduct and image at all times; establish and maintain an acceptable attendance record; and participate in extra-curricular activities and/or leadership roles outside the classroom. Continue to grow as a professional educator with classes/workshops for professional development in specific areas of interest and/or need and coaching and feedback from administrators and peers.
